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
---|---|
$57,375.00 or less | 15% |
$57,375.00 - $114,749.99 | 20.5% |
$114,750.00 - $177,881.99 | 26% |
$177,882.00 - $253,413.99 | 29% |
More than $253,414.00 | 33% |
Prince Edward Island Tax Bracket | Prince Edward Island Tax Rates |
---|---|
$33,328.00 or less | 9.5% |
$33,328.00 - $64,655.99 | 13.47% |
$64,656.00 - $104,999.99 | 16.6% |
$105,000.00 - $139,999.99 | 17.62% |
More than $140,000.00 | 19% |

Region | Total Income | Total Deductions | Net Pay | Avg. Tax Rate | Comp. Deduction Rate |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Nunavut | $81,607.76 | $18,899.37 | $62,708.39 | 16.41% | 23.16% |
British Columbia | $81,607.76 | $19,880.23 | $61,727.53 | 17.61% | 24.36% |
Northwest Territories | $81,607.76 | $20,077.14 | $61,530.62 | 17.85% | 24.6% |
Yukon | $81,607.76 | $20,218.68 | $61,389.08 | 18.03% | 24.78% |
Ontario | $81,607.76 | $20,957.62 | $60,650.14 | 18.93% | 25.68% |
Alberta | $81,607.76 | $21,261.25 | $60,346.51 | 19.3% | 26.05% |
Saskatchewan | $81,607.76 | $22,448.51 | $59,159.25 | 20.76% | 27.51% |
Manitoba | $81,607.76 | $23,050.64 | $58,557.12 | 21.5% | 28.25% |
New Brunswick | $81,607.76 | $23,165.24 | $58,442.52 | 21.64% | 28.39% |
Newfoundland and Labrador | $81,607.76 | $23,697.71 | $57,910.05 | 22.29% | 29.04% |
Prince Edward Island | $81,607.76 | $24,201.08 | $57,406.68 | 22.91% | 29.66% |
Quebec | $81,607.76 | $24,299.72 | $57,308.04 | 22.43% | 29.78% |
Nova Scotia | $81,607.76 | $25,292.83 | $56,314.93 | 24.24% | 30.99% |
